Answer Yes or No to each question honestly. This is a private tool — no results are stored or shared with anyone. It takes under two minutes.
Have you ever spent more money gaming than you originally planned?
Have you ever tried to win back money you lost through more bets?
Have you kept your gaming activity secret from someone close to you?
Do you find yourself thinking about gaming when you should be focused on something else?
Have you ever used borrowed money — from anyone — for gaming?
Have you tried to stop or reduce gaming and found it difficult?
Has gaming affected your sleep, work, or relationships negatively?
Do you feel anxious, irritable, or low on days when you haven't gamed?
